Government
The Government of the State of Fenson is divided into three branches. The first is the Legislative branch made up by the Senate. Each District elects 3 members of senate. If the consuls veto a bill in Senate, the Senate can vote on it again. If the bill gets a two thirds majority, the legislation passes without having to go through the executive branch. If the senate disagrees with one of the consuls, a member may call for a motion of no confidence. If the vote gets a two thirds majority and at least of of the consuls that isn't the target for the vote agrees, the motion passes and the targeted consul leaves office and is replaced by the people or the Senate, depending on who put them into office.

The next branch is the Executive Consuls. The Council is made of up two consuls elected on a state level, picked by the citizens using the alternative vote, and one elected by the Senate. If two of them agree, they can veto any legislation passed in the Senate. The consuls can also declare war if they all unanimously agree.
